This annular displacement of the radial head is commonly fixed by what motion

What is hyperpronation (then supination with flexion)

This bony abnormality presents most commonly in pre-adolescent males - can be especially seen in Sickle Cell Disease

What is Legg-Calve-Perthes disease (osteonecrosis of the femoral head

This occurs when the femoral head is displaced posteriorly and inferiorly to the femoral neck secondary to a fracture parallel to the growth plate.

What is SCFE

This is the background positivity rate of ANA in healthy children and adolescents within 5% points

What is 15-20% - this and RF/CCP are not diagnostic for JIA, an initial workup includes CBC w/diff, CMP, ESR, CRP, and UA

Fractures of these bones are the most specific to abuse and should raise suspicion

What are the posterior ribs, scapula, spinous process, and sternal fractures

These 5 parental risk factors increase your likelihood of sustaining child maltreatment (will accept 3/5)

What is being a teen parent, having a history of substance abuse, previous child maltreatment, single parenthood, cognitive deficit/other mental illness. Other risks include poverty, children with mental illness, multiple children under the age of 5, intimate-partner violence, disabled, children of multiple gestations

These are the Four Kocher Criteria for septic arthritis

What are the inability to bear weight (TS can sometimes have a limp), Fever > 38.3C, ESR > 40, WBC count > 12,000.

These 3 things distinguish corporeal punishment from physical abuse (accept 1 answer)

What are hitting with an object other than the hand, striking with intensity hard enough to leave a mark for more than a few minutes, anger
